Data Science Innovation with Z by HP Workstations, Remote Collaboration and Software Stack

Abstract: 

Z by HP is bringing exceptional technology -both hardware and software- to data scientists, analysts, and creatives that is built for the demands of heavy data processing workloads, right out of the box. With Z laptops, desktops, or rack-mounted data science computers, you get high-performance computers that complement your cloud infrastructure, reduce latency of heavy workloads, make collaboration more efficient, and secure your data end to end. Critical data science software is pre-loaded on the machine – Tensorflow, PyTorch, python, and docker to name a few-with your choice of a Linux or windows subsystem for Linux (2) operating system. This ensures each program works seamlessly with the right version of your OS and other supporting software.

HP ZCentral Remote Boost allows user to access Z workstation power from an end point device of choice. All the tools and hardware are set to enhance your efficiency and equipping you to be productive from day one.

Bio: 

Paras Varshney is a Data Scientist at LogicAI and an Ex-Data Scientist from IISc. Bangalore. He has been working on building competitive machine learning pipelines and automating the competitive ecosystem for the "Kaggle Days x Z by HP Global Data Science Championship". He also developed the systems to manage the high throughput data ingestion pipelines for smart cities' big data. Recognized within the top 1% of Kaggle worldwide, Paras likes to share his passion for data science by helping junior coders develop programming skills through an online classroom. He also loves writing, and his works can be found in top digital publications such as Towards Data Science.
